Administrative Assistant
We are seeking a highly organized and proactive Administrative Assistant to join our dynamic marketing team . In this essential role you will ensure projects and daily activities run smoothly and efficiently. Reporting to the Director of Marketing Operations and Communications, you will handle a wide range of administrative and logistical tasks that are critical to our team's success. If you are a master of multitasking with a keen eye for detail and a can-do attitude, we want to hear from you.
As the Administrative Assistant for the marketing team , you will be responsible for a variety of key functions:
• Financial Administration : Process and meticulously track all marketing invoices for timely payment, maintaining accurate records.
• Logistics Coordination: Manage sponsorship logistics for events and partnerships, ensuring all requirements are met. Oversee fulfillment center logistics, including managing inventory and coordinating orders.
• Event Support: Take charge of ordering and tracking all necessary materials for marketing events, from banners and signage to promotional items, ensuring everything arrives on time and to specification.
• Team Onboarding: Facilitate a smooth and welcoming onboarding process for new hires within the marketing department, ensuring they have the necessary tools, access, and introductions to get started effectively.
• Meeting & Schedule Management: Organize and coordinate team meetings, including scheduling, booking rooms, and arranging any necessary technology or catering.
• Project Support: Provide administrative support across multiple, simultaneous marketing projects, helping to keep deliverables on track and team members aligned.

QualificationsWe are looking for a candidate who possesses the following skills and qualifications:
• Exceptional Organizational Skills: You have a proven ability to manage multiple priorities, projects, and deadlines in a fast-paced environment without sacrificing quality.
• Strong Communication: You are an excellent communicator, both written and verbal, with the ability to interact professionally and effectively with internal team members, external partners, and vendors.
• Reliable Follow-Up: You are diligent and persistent in following up on action items, ensuring tasks are completed and nothing falls through the cracks.
• Excel Proficiency: You are comfortable and skilled in using Microsoft Excel for tracking, reporting, and data management.
• Proactive Mindset: You are a self-starter who can anticipate needs, identify potential challenges, and take initiative to find solutions.
• Team Player: You have a positive and collaborative attitude, ready to support the team wherever needed.
Education: Bachelor’s degree in marketing, business administration, or a related field in required
Additional Requirements: Expertise in MS Office including MS Outlook, Teams, Word, and Excel required.

UniFirst is an international leader in garment & Uniform services industry. We currently employ over 14,000 team partners who serve 300,000 business customer locations throughout the U.S., Canada, and Europe.
We were included in the top 10 of Selling Power magazine’s “Best Companies to Sell For” list and recognized on Forbes magazine’s “Platinum 400 – Best Big Companies” list. As an 80-year old company focused on annual growth, there’s never been a better time to join our team.
